Thanks everyone for the replies. I went back after a break and re-read the message that concerned me. It is in the admin section under Feed Status. I think I am ok and this message is an either/or. I put my shop on hold while I get things just the way I want them, or close anyway. The message stated that eCRATER cannot handle the feed because either my shop is on hold (which it is) or I am using the eCRATER URL in another Google Merchant Center account (which I am not). I am assuming that putting the shop on hold prompted this message. I am going to forge ahead under this assumption and see what happens. I learn something new here everyday. Since you are a new shop it will take a few days, I think about 10, for them to set up things in order to send the Google feed. At least that is what I was told when I asked. Until then you'll get those messages. Just today it said my feed was active and the similar message to yours went away. I opened on June 4th. So add items and tweak as you go. Best of luck to you. |
